⚡Notice of Exemption Surrender for Chapman Dam Hydroelectric Project

The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ission has accepted for filing The Dam, LLC's application for surrendering its exemption related to the Chapman Dam Hydroelectric Project. The notice invites public comments and interventions, detailing the project's status as inoperable and the implications for compliance and environmental review.

🌊Notice of Intent for Scott's Mill Hydroelectric Environmental Assessment

The Department of Energy has issued a notice regarding the Scott's Mill Hydro, LLC's license application for a 4.5-megawatt hydropower project on the James River, Virginia. The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ission will prepare an Environmental Assessment to evaluate potential impacts and gather public comments before finalizing the licensing decision.

🌿Proposed Delisting of Virginia Sneezeweed and Business Implications

We, the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service (Service), propose to remove Virginia sneezeweed (Helenium virginicum) from the Federal List of Endangered and Threatened Plants. Our review indicates that the threats to Virginia sneezeweed have been eliminated or reduced to the point that the species no longer meets the definition of an endangered or threatened species under the Endangered Species Act of 1973, as amended (Act). Accordingly, we propose to delist Virginia sneezeweed. If we finalize this rule as proposed, the prohibitions and conservation measures provided by the Act, particularly through sections 7 and 9, would no longer apply to Virginia sneezeweed.

🌉Coast Guard Removes Drawbridge Operation Regulation for VA

The Coast Guard is removing the existing drawbridge operation regulation for the Dominion Boulevard (US17) Bridge, mile 8.8 across the Southern Branch of the Elizabeth River in Chesapeake, VA. The Dominion Boulevard (US17) Drawbridge has been removed in its entirety and replaced with a high-level fixed bridge as of October 20, 2016. The operating regulation for the bridge is no longer applicable or necessary and will be removed from the CFR.

🎨Notice of Intended Repatriation at Virginia Museum of Fine Arts

In accordance with the Native American Graves Protection and Repatriation Act (NAGPRA), the Virginia Museum of Fine Arts intends to repatriate certain cultural items that meet the definition of objects of cultural patrimony and that have a cultural affiliation with the Indian Tribes or Native Hawaiian organizations in this notice.

🚂Norfolk Southern Railway Discontinuance Exemption - Business Impact

Norfolk Southern Railway Company has filed for an exemption to discontinue service on an 11-mile rail line in Virginia. The submission certifies no traffic has used the line in two years and outlines conditions for employee protection. Interested parties can submit offers for financial assistance to maintain service, with specific procedural requirements and deadlines.

⚡Eagle Creek Reusens Hydro, LLC Environmental Assessment Notice

The U.S. Department of Energy announces an Environmental Assessment (EA) for the Reusens Hydroelectric Project relicense application by Eagle Creek Reusens Hydro, LLC. The EA will be prepared after identifying no major environmental impacts, and all comments on the EA will be considered in the final licensing decision, emphasizing public engagement and participation.

✈️Amendment of Class D and E Airspace Over Hampton Roads, VA

This action proposes to amend Class D airspace and establish Class E airspace extending upward from the surface above Langley Air Force Base (AFB), Hampton Roads, VA, as the air traffic control tower will shift to part-time operations. This action also proposes to update the geographic coordinates of the airport. Controlled airspace is necessary for the safety and management of instrument flight rules (IFR) operations in the area.

🐟Roanoke Logperch Delisting and Its Impact on Business Operations

We, the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service (Service), are removing the Roanoke logperch (Percina rex), a freshwater fish in the perch family (Percidae), from the Federal List of Endangered and Threatened Wildlife. After a review of the best scientific and commercial data available, we find that delisting the species is warranted. Our review indicates that the threats to the Roanoke logperch have been eliminated or reduced to the point that the species no longer meets the definition of an endangered or threatened species under the Endangered Species Act of 1973, as amended (Act). Accordingly, the prohibitions and conservation measures provided by the Act, particularly through sections 7 and 9, will no longer apply to the Roanoke logperch.

🚚Correction of Driver Exemption Renewal by FMCSA

FMCSA corrects its July 7, 2025, notice provisionally renewing an exemption for truck and bus drivers who are licensed in the Commonwealth of Virginia and need a Skill Performance Evaluation (SPE) Certificate to operate commercial motor vehicles (CMV) in interstate commerce. The expiration date for the provisional renewal was incorrectly published as July 8, 2030. The correct expiration date is January 8, 2026.
